Pakawala wrote:I have my own avitar photo but don't know how to get it down to the minimum size required so I can place it on my profile page. I've got several graphics and photo programs, any of which I'm sure would be able to handle the task... I'm just too dumb to understand how. Any help offered would be appreciated. The photo is currently at 72K.


That's an easy one. Do you have photoshop on your computer? If so, open your picture in that program, select the crop tool and enter 100px in width and height. Go to your picture and drag the crop tool around your photo and tick ok. Next go to save for web and select jpeg medium or high. This should give you something about 5k in size.
